WebJul 21, 2024 · The first step in DNA replication is to ‘unzip’ the double helix structure of the DNA molecule.; This is carried out by an enzyme called helicase which breaks the hydrogen bonds holding the complementary bases of DNA together (A with T, C with G).; The separation of the two single strands of DNA creates a ‘Y’ shape called a replication ‘fork’.
